AP English Language and Composition focuses on rhetorical analysis, argument, and synthesis—skills tested through multiple-choice questions, free-response essays, and timed writing tasks. Students learn to analyze how authors use language and persuasive techniques, develop their own arguments using evidence, and synthesize multiple sources into cohesive responses. The course emphasizes close reading, critical thinking, and the ability to write under pressure, which are essential for both the AP exam and college-level coursework.

Many 11th graders struggle with time management during the exam—balancing thorough analysis with quick composition across three essays in 225 minutes. Others find it difficult to distinguish between different rhetorical strategies or to develop arguments with sufficient evidence and analysis rather than summary. Reading comprehension under pressure and maintaining consistent essay structure while thinking critically are also frequent pain points. Practice tests are essential—they help you understand the exam format, build stamina for the full 3-hour 15-minute test, and identify your specific weak areas under real time pressure. Taking full-length, timed practice tests every 2-3 weeks allows you to track progress and get comfortable with question types and essay prompts. Many tutors use practice test results as a starting point for focused instruction, so you're not just practicing but learning from each attempt.
